Construction exec sells on Upper East Side for $1.825M

by Kathy Noyes, published Aug. 27, 2009

Hal Sokoloff and Marla Sokoloff sold condo Unit #8B at 188 E. 76th St. on the Upper East Side to Hardin Enterprises Inc. for $1.825 million on July 24.

The Sokoloffs acquired the property for $1.8875 million in June 2005. The condo is in The Siena, a condominium high-rise built in 1996 that houses 73 units on 31 floors.

Mr. Solokoff has served as the president of H&L Electric, Inc., a construction company located in Long Island.

There were 175 condo sales on the Upper East Side in 2008, with a median price of $955,000.
